INFN-LNS is proceeding with the upgrade of the Superconducting Cyclotron. The final goal is to increase the extraction efficiency in order to achieve a beam power up to 10 kW. The RF systems are also undergoing significant improvements through several upgrades. The new control system architecture will be able to manage the LLRF system, HLRF devices, and beam pulsing systems. The new software allows more accurate management of all RF parameters and centralized control of peripheral devices. This architecture enables simultaneous control of cavity phase, amplitude and tuning loops, monitoring of power amplifier parameters, protection and fault diagnosis, and integration with various acquisition and measurement systems. The power amplifiers and drive systems involved in the tuning and coupling of the resonant cavities have also undergone substantial refurbishment. All these developments are detailed in this paper.
